Bryson puts up 22 as Howard takes down North Carolina Central 100-67

WASHINGTON (AP) — Travelle Bryson’s 22 points off the bench helped Howard defeat North Carolina Central 100-67 on Saturday.

Bryson also had eight rebounds for the Bison (18-10, 8-3 Mid-Eastern Athletic Conference). Cedric Taylor III scored 21 points and added six rebounds, six assists, and four blocks. Bryce Harris shot 6 of 12 from the field and 4 of 4 from the free-throw line to finish with 17 points.

Kyric Davis led the Eagles (10-16, 6-5) in scoring, finishing with 23 points and three steals. Kelechi Okworogwo added 20 points and eight rebounds for North Carolina Central. Gage Lattimore finished with 10 points, five assists and two steals.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
